## Runbook: Fan-Out Backpressure

When the Signalgate notifier saturates, the fan-out workers shed load by pausing low-priority topics. Verify the backpressure flag in the dispatcher metrics before intervening; forced resumes can replay messages and duplicate alerts. Access is audited, and all manual actions require a change ticket. To inspect the throttle state table, connect to the dispatch database using the connection string below.

replica DSN, tawef-hahap: mysql://eliix_svc:FiIC0jz@db-394a.lumiclabs.internal:5432/holius

**Runbook: PointsPerch Ledger Resync**

Welcome aboard! If the loyalty-points ledger drifts from the checkout totals, don't panic — it's usually a stuck reconciliation job. Run the `perch-resync` script in dry-run mode first and eyeball the diff. Anything over 500 points needs a second pair of eyes from the Ledger Guild. Once you've confirmed the resync, note the build that produced the fix below.

build token for kagaf-hahof: htk14_9d3d4d26d7d8de

☐ **Shared lab access — Orella Systems new starters.** Confirm the starter has completed the safety briefing before granting entry to Lab 4, which we share with the Halverton instrumentation team. Walk them to the lab, point out the equipment sign-out sheet, and remind them the door must never be propped open. The lab keypad code, which they will need from day one, is:

door code, yagap-bahof: bdg-O-05

### Step 4: Repoint the partner SFTP drop

After the Larkspur migration completes, inbound partner files land on the new Oxbine drop host instead of the legacy box. Support should verify that each partner's first upload appears within the usual window. Legacy paths stay read-only for 30 days. The new connection settings to share with partners are listed below.

service settings:
[silwyn]
host = silwyn.crelvogrid.internal
user = silwyn_svc
database = silwyn_prod